The Global Antimicrobial Susceptibility Testing (AST) Instrument Market was valued at USD 4.1 billion in 2023 and is projected to reach USD 7.9 billion by 2031, growing at a CAGR of 8.4% during the forecast period from 2023 to 2031. The market's robust growth is driven by the escalating prevalence of antimicrobial resistance (AMR), rising global infection rates, and the demand for rapid and accurate diagnostic methods. Antimicrobial susceptibility testing instruments play a crucial role in identifying the most effective antibiotic treatments, ensuring better patient outcomes, and aiding global health authorities in AMR surveillance programs.
Drivers:
1. Growing Incidence of Antimicrobial
Resistance (AMR):
The alarming rise in drug-resistant
infections has made AST instruments indispensable in clinical laboratories. As
pathogens continue to develop resistance to standard antibiotics,
susceptibility testing has become vital for determining targeted therapies.
2. Increasing Hospital-Acquired Infections
(HAIs):
HAIs are a growing concern, particularly in
intensive care units. The urgent need for infection control and the effective
use of antibiotics is pushing healthcare facilities to adopt AST instruments
for precise treatment selection.
3. Technological Advancements in AST
Systems:
Innovations such as microfluidics,
automation, and AI-integrated testing platforms are enhancing accuracy and
reducing turnaround times. These developments are making AST instruments more
reliable and user-friendly for clinical workflows.
Restraints:
1. High Cost of AST Instruments and
Consumables:
Initial investment and maintenance costs
for AST equipment can be high, particularly for automated systems, posing a
challenge for small or resource-constrained laboratories.
2. Regulatory and Standardization
Challenges:
The variability in global regulations and
the lack of harmonized protocols for AST can hinder market penetration and the
consistent performance of these instruments across different regions.
Opportunity:
1. Rising Demand in Emerging Economies:
Developing countries are investing in
healthcare infrastructure, driving demand for advanced diagnostic tools like
AST instruments. Increased public health funding is further accelerating
adoption.
2. Expansion of Personalized Medicine and
Rapid Testing:
The growth of personalized and precision
medicine is creating opportunities for rapid AST instruments capable of
delivering actionable data in hours rather than days, thereby enhancing
clinical decision-making.
3. Integration with Laboratory Information
Systems (LIS):
As laboratories become more digitized,
integrating AST platforms with LIS is improving workflow efficiency and
compliance, creating additional demand for high-tech systems.
Market
by System Type Insights:
The Automated AST Instruments segment
dominated the market in 2023, accounting for the highest revenue share. These
systems are widely adopted due to their speed, precision, and ability to
process a high volume of samples with minimal manual intervention. However,
manual and semi-automated instruments remain relevant in smaller labs or
resource-limited settings due to their affordability.
Market
by End-use Insights:
The Hospitals & Diagnostic Laboratories
segment was the largest end-use category in 2023, contributing over 45% of the
total revenue. These institutions rely heavily on AST instruments to guide
antibiotic prescriptions and manage infectious disease outbreaks. The
pharmaceutical and biotechnology companies segment is also witnessing notable
growth due to its role in drug discovery and development.
Market
by Regional Insights:
North America led the global AST instrument
market in 2023, supported by strong healthcare infrastructure, proactive
government initiatives to combat AMR, and widespread awareness among
clinicians. Meanwhile, Asia-Pacific is anticipated to experience the fastest
growth during the forecast period due to increasing healthcare expenditure,
improving laboratory capacities, and higher infection burden in densely
populated countries like India and China.
Competitive
Scenario:
Key players in the global antimicrobial
susceptibility testing instrument market include bioMérieux SA, Thermo Fisher
Scientific Inc., BD (Becton, Dickinson and Company), Danaher Corporation,
Bio-Rad Laboratories, Merck KGaA, Bruker Corporation, Liofilchem S.r.l.,
Accelerate Diagnostics Inc., and Roche Diagnostics. These companies are
focusing on launching advanced testing platforms, forging strategic
partnerships, and expanding into emerging markets.

Key
Market Developments:
In February 2024, BD launched a
next-generation AST platform with integrated AI for real-time data
interpretation and early detection of resistant strains.
In October 2023, bioMérieux expanded its
AST instrument product line with faster, more compact systems aimed at mid-size
diagnostic labs.
In June 2023, Thermo Fisher Scientific
introduced a cloud-enabled AST system that allows remote monitoring and
compliance tracking for multi-site laboratories.
In April 2022, Accelerate Diagnostics
received FDA clearance for its rapid AST system tailored for bloodstream
infections, significantly reducing turnaround time.
